Output d407062c9932af7b2bd897d9c72bb992b516bf6a8fa14edf6272607758b99994:1

value
14052489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ffe90c84cbb3a33608acc38cf8c6961a82cfc1275fb2fc02d1f24f5661bc292a
address
tb1pll5sepxtkw3nvz9vcwx0335kr2pvlsf8t7e0cqk37f84vcdu9y4qkhgvct
transaction
d407062c9932af7b2bd897d9c72bb992b516bf6a8fa14edf6272607758b99994
confirmations
22016
spent
true